Output 4074148c650f3436ebb88e9f78a6c1a4133f169b00c512ca7a815f10678ccd51:0

value
12700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5181a3c96087b56a16a38dc57c1e29d0c0ad69a OP_EQUAL
address
3JCZ6wCK1ZvkTv3GgRgyGJbej43GNht6Z4
transaction
4074148c650f3436ebb88e9f78a6c1a4133f169b00c512ca7a815f10678ccd51
spent
true